should know that the RL, RLOD and the ROD
in the abbreviation mean “red light”, “red lights of
death”, “red ring of death or doom”.
Now that we’ve got the definitions out of the way, we’d like to
say that the 3 red lights of death have been the boon of
Microsoft’s xBox 360 ever since it came out in the market in
2005.
Some sources have estimated that out of the 18
million xBox 360 units that have been sold all over the world,
around 30% of them have been bogged down by overheating. Don’t
worry, it’s not your fault. None of it is ever your fault if
you’re just a gamer trying out the latest trends in gaming fun.
Microsoft itself has committed some major blunders in design by
downsizing the LSI heat sink. Although Microsoft does not admit
it, this is the major flaw in the xBox’s hardware design.
A reduced heat sink to accommodate a DVD
drive makes the xBox console very prone to overheating. On a
very hot day your console could be as hot as 100 degrees, not F
but C or Centigrade.

The 3 red lights on the power button (all sections of the button
are lighted up in red except for the top right hand side) are
all you need to see to know if your gaming console needs an 3 RL
xBox fix.
The 3 red rings of death\doom are indication that xBox is having very serious general hardware problems.
